Main Cost Influences
Exterior wood cladding is a popular choice for enhancing the appearance and protection of buildings in Carlisle, MA. Understanding the typical scope and considerations can help in planning a project and comparing options effectively.
- Materials: Common options include cedar, redwood, and pressure-treated pine, each offering different durability and aesthetic qualities suitable for Carlisle’s climate.
- Size and Scope: Projects can range from small accent walls to full building exteriors, with scope influencing overall costs and planning requirements.
- Labor Complexity: Installation involves precise measurement, cutting, and fastening, with complexity depending on design details and existing structure conditions.
- Permitting: Local regulations in Carlisle may require permits for exterior cladding projects, especially for larger or structural modifications.
- Additional Options: Treatments such as staining, sealing, or custom finishes can be included to enhance durability and appearance.
Project Size Considerations
Exterior wood cladding projects in Carlisle, MA, typically vary in scope and size, influencing overall costs. The following table provides a general overview of common project sizes and their typical cost ranges to assist in comparison and budgeting considerations.
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Small residential accent wall (up to 100 sq ft) | $1,000 - $3,000 |
| Standard house siding (1,000 - 2,000 sq ft) | $10,000 - $30,000 |
| Large commercial building (over 5,000 sq ft) | $50,000 - $150,000+ |
| Replacement or repair of existing cladding | $3,000 - $20,000 |
| Custom design or intricate patterns | Varies widely, typically $15,000+ |
Prices are approximate and may vary based on project specifics, site conditions, and material choices within Carlisle, MA.
